Find T Critical Value in Excel

Understanding T Critical Value

The t critical value is integral to hypothesis testing, helping assess if results are due to random chance. It's derived from the t-distribution, which is applicable when dealing with small sample sizes or unknown population standard deviations.

Using Excel's T.INV.2T Function

To calculate the t critical value in Excel, use the T.INV.2T function. It requires a significance level and degrees of freedom, corresponding to the desired confidence interval and sample size minus one, respectively.

Step-by-Step Calculation

Enter the T.INV.2T function in a cell, input the significance level (alpha) for your test, and the degrees of freedom (df). Excel returns the t critical value, which you can use for determining the confidence intervals in your analysis.

Frequently Asked Questions

How do I find the t critical value for a one-tailed test in Excel?

Use the T.INV() function. The syntax is T.INV(probability,deg_freedom), where probability is your significance level and deg_freedom is your degrees of freedom.

How do I find the t critical value for a two-tailed test in Excel?

Use the T.INV.2T() function. For example, =T.INV.2T(0.05,29) calculates the critical value of t for a two-tailed test with 29 degrees of freedom and alpha = .05.

What are common errors when calculating t critical values in Excel?

The T.INV function returns errors if: 1) arguments are nonnumeric (#VALUE!), 2) probability is less than 0 or greater than 1 (#NUM!), or 3) degrees of freedom is less than 1 (#NUM!).
